A copper-alloy Roman radiate of Allectus dating to the period AD 293-296 (Reece period 14), (PAX AVG), Pax standing left holding branch and vertical sceptre. C Mint, S P // C. RIC V, pt 2, p. 566, cf. no. 85. This coin is included in Sam Moorhead's corpus for RIC.
